Why was I charged $25 when the system said $20?

TTax $20.jpgTTax $25.jpgOkay, here we are one year later, and exactly the same thing is happening. Updated software (Fed & State) an hour ago. Payment page says cost to eFile State will be $20, but after entering credit card info, the payment jumps to $25.

Why was I charged $25 when the system said $20?

@PeteDun The state e-file charge was $20 prior to March 1.  On March 1 the price increased to $25.  If you updated your software on or after March 1 the program screen would have shown the $25 price for e-filing a state tax return.

Also, this fee can be avoided by printing and mailing the state tax return.
